Soten
Character of the water
Soten lies in the south — a southern clear oligotrophic forest lake.
The surroundings
The lake lies remote, ringed by forest and bog far from any road. Few find their way here — the water is untouched and the stock undisturbed.
Moderately deep (5 m) — shallow bays, the odd reef and a deeper channel through the middle.
Permits & rules
Fishing permit required — Soten FVOF. Day permit ~140 kr · annual permit ~700 kr.
- Pike: keep at most one over 75 cm per day.
- Handheld tackle only. Respect the protected zones at the inlets and outlets.
